Perfecting the Cooking Process

To achieve perfectly baked lemon poppy seed cupcakes, start by preheating your oven while you prepare your batter. Combine dry ingredients first, followed by wet ones, and mix until just combined to avoid overmixing, ensuring a light texture.

Add Your Touch

Consider incorporating different citrus zest or extracts to enhance flavor. You can also swap out poppy seeds for chia seeds or add a fruit filling for a unique twist that complements the lemon base.

Storing & Reheating

Store your lemon poppy seed cupcakes in an airtight container at room temperature for up to three days. For longer storage, refrigerate for up to a week or freeze them for up to three months. Reheat gently in the microwave if desired.

Expert Tips for Success

  • Use fresh lemon juice and zest for the brightest flavor in your cupcakes.
  • Ensure all ingredients are at room temperature for better mixing and rise.
  • Avoid overfilling cupcake liners to prevent overflow during baking.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the best way to store Lemon Poppy Seed Cupcakes?

Lemon Poppy Seed Cupcakes should be stored in an airtight container at room temperature for up to three days. If you want to keep them fresh longer, refrigerate them, but allow them to come to room temperature before serving for the best flavor and texture.

Can I freeze Lemon Poppy Seed Cupcakes?

Yes, you can freeze Lemon Poppy Seed Cupcakes! Wrap them individually in plastic wrap and then place them in a freezer-safe bag. They can be stored in the freezer for up to three months. Thaw before enjoying!

What variations can I try with Lemon Poppy Seed Cupcakes?

There are many delicious variations of Lemon Poppy Seed Cupcakes. You can add blueberries or raspberries for a fruity twist, substitute alcohol-free almond extract for a unique flavor, or top with different types of frosting, such as cream cheese or lemon glaze.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 ½ c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 cup granulated sugar
  • ½ cup unsalted butter, softened
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1/2 cup milk
  • Zest of 1 lemon
  • 2 tablespoons poppy seeds
  • 1 teaspoon baking powder

Instructions

  1. Step 1: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and line a cupcake tin with paper liners.
  2. Step 2: In a mixing bowl, cream together the softened butter and granulated sugar until light and fluffy.
  3. Step 3: Add the eggs one at a time, mixing well after each addition. Then stir in the lemon zest and poppy seeds.
  4. Step 4: In a separate bowl, whisk together the flour and baking powder. Gradually add this dry mixture to the wet ingredients, alternating with the milk, starting and ending with the flour mixture.
  5. Step 5: Divide the batter evenly among the prepared cupcake liners and bake for about 18-20 minutes or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ean. Let cool before serving.

Notes

  • For optimal freshness, store your lemon poppy seed cupcakes in an airtight container at room temperature for up to three days, or refrigerate them for up to a week.
  • If you want to enjoy your cupcakes warm, simply pop them in the microwave for about 10-15 seconds, or reheat in a preheated oven at 300°F (150°C) for a few minutes until warmed through.
  • These cupcakes pair wonderfully with a light lemon glaze or a dollop of whipped cream and fresh berries for an extra touch of flavor and presentation.
  • For a more vibrant lemon flavor, consider adding a bit more lemon zest than the recipe calls for; it will elevate the citrus notes beautifully!
